Web14 feb. 2024 · Studies conducted by Media Matters for America reveals, “Sixty percent of the nation's daily newspapers print more conservative syndicated columnists every week than progressive syndicated columnists. In a given week, nationally syndicated progressive columnists are published in newspapers with a combined total circulation of 125 million. WebThe bias or perceived bias of journalists and news producers within the mass media in the selection of events and stories that are reported and how they are covered. Leaving one side out of an article, or a series of articles over a period of time. Including more sources that support one view over another. A pattern of highlighting news stories ...
